## 6.6 libp2p interface and UX
|
||||
|
||||
libp2p implementations should enable for it to be instantiated programatically, or to use a previous compiled lib some of the protocol decisions already made, so that the user can reuse or expand.
|
||||
|
||||
### Constructing libp2p instance programatically
|
||||
|
||||
Example made with JavaScript, should be mapped to other languages
|
||||
|
||||
```JavaScript
|
||||
var Libp2p = require('libp2p')
|
||||
|
||||
var node = new Libp2p()
|
||||
|
||||
// add a swarm instance
|
||||
node.addSwarm(swarmInstance)
|
||||
|
||||
// add one or more Peer Routing mechanisms
|
||||
node.addPeerRouting(peerRoutingInstance)
|
||||
|
||||
// add a Distributed Record Store
|
||||
node.addDistributedRecordStore(distributedRecordStoreInstance)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Configuring libp2p is quite straight forward since most of the configuration comes from instantiating the several modules, one at each time.
|
||||
|
||||
### Dialing and Listening for connections to/from a peer
|
||||
|
||||
Ideally, libp2p uses its own mechanisms (PeerRouting and Record Store) to find a way to dial to a given peer
|
||||
|
||||
```JavaScript
|
||||
node.dial(PeerInfo)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
To receive an incoming connection, specify one or more protocols to handle
|
||||
|
||||
```JavaScript
|
||||
node.handleProtocol('<multicodec>', function (duplexStream) {
|
||||
|
||||
})
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### Finding a peer
|
||||
|
||||
Finding a peer functionality is done through Peer Routing, so the interface is the same.
|
||||
|
||||
### Storing and Retrieving Records
|
||||
|
||||
Like Finding a Peer, Storing and Retrieving records is done through Record Store, so the interface is the same.
